Output c5873df7e006e33f59dcb4f4266cd16215aee4587713ab9f9a416e80ec456faa:6

value
10567719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f658cf7db872fdc696a34778a66b8783e40d6a0 OP_EQUAL
address
3LbdT7gU529oCnnsWhcvVZiwGPixzeYXLa
transaction
c5873df7e006e33f59dcb4f4266cd16215aee4587713ab9f9a416e80ec456faa
spent
true